Dimension gap under Sobolev mappings

2015

Abstract We prove an essentially sharp estimate in terms of generalized Hausdorff measures for the images of boundaries of Holder domains under continuous Sobolev mappings, satisfying suitable Orlicz–Sobolev conditions. This estimate marks a dimension gap, which was first observed in [2] for conformal mappings.

Notions of Dirichlet problem for functions of least gradient in metric measure spaces

2019

We study two notions of Dirichlet problem associated with BV energy minimizers (also called functions of least gradient) in bounded domains in metric measure spaces whose measure is doubling and supports a (1, 1)-Poincaré inequality. Since one of the two notions is not amenable to the direct method of the calculus of variations, we construct, based on an approach of Juutinen and Mazón-Rossi–De León, solutions by considering the Dirichlet problem for p-harmonic functions, p>1, and letting p→1. Tools developed and used in this paper include the inner perimeter measure of a domain. Peer reviewed

Derivatives not first return integrable on a fractal set

2018

We extend to s-dimensional fractal sets the notion of first return integral (Definition 5) and we prove that there are s-derivatives not s-first return integrable.
